NADRA Launches Nishan Pakistan Initiative for Digital Identity System

Pakistan has taken a major step toward a stronger digital economy in 2026 with the launch of Nishan Pakistan, a unified digital identity verification platform introduced by National Database and Registration Authority (NADRA).

The initiative is designed to modernize how government departments and regulated private institutions verify citizen identities — making the process faster, safer, and fully digital.

Why Nishan Pakistan Matters Now

Over the years, identity verification in Pakistan relied on semi-digital systems and manual approvals. This often meant delays, repeated documentation, and limited transparency.

With Nishan Pakistan, NADRA has introduced a centralized web-based portal that serves as a single digital gateway for identity verification services.

This shift is especially important in 2026 as Pakistan expands online banking, fintech services, telecom registrations, and digital welfare programs.

What Exactly Is Nishan Pakistan?

Nishan Pakistan (NP) is a secure online platform that allows authorized government bodies and regulated private organizations to access NADRA’s identity verification services through a standardized digital system.

Instead of fragmented procedures, institutions can now:

  • Digitally onboard through one portal

  • Access verification APIs securely

  • Ensure regulatory compliance under updated data-sharing rules

The system operates under NADRA’s revised regulatory framework, including recent identity verification regulations introduced this year.

Key Features of the New Digital Identity System

The platform supports multiple verification tools that strengthen fraud prevention and customer authentication.

Core Services Available Under Nishan Pakistan

Feature Purpose
Multi-Biometric Verification Fingerprint & facial recognition authentication
Verisys System Demographic & identity verification
Proof-of-Life API Confirms active identity status
Secure Single Sign-On (SSO) Controlled system access for institutions

These tools are particularly useful for:

  • Banks and microfinance institutions

  • Electronic Money Institutions (EMIs)

  • Telecom companies

  • Government welfare departments

The system ensures data protection, purpose limitation, and lawful access, reducing misuse of personal information.

How This Supports Pakistan’s Digital Economy

Nishan Pakistan is launched under the government’s broader Digital Economy Enhancement Project (DEEP), focusing on secure digital infrastructure.

As more services move online in 2026 — including financial inclusion programs and social support initiatives — accurate identity verification becomes critical.

For example, welfare disbursement schemes require quick and reliable identity checks to prevent duplication or fraud. With this platform, departments can verify applicants instantly and securely.

This strengthens trust in public service delivery and improves efficiency for citizens.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Nishan Pakistan for individual citizens to register?
No, it is designed for government bodies and regulated private organizations to access NADRA’s verification services.

Does this replace CNIC cards?
No, the CNIC system remains in place. Nishan Pakistan strengthens the digital verification process linked to existing identity records.

Is biometric verification included in the system?
Yes, the platform supports fingerprint and facial recognition verification tools.

How does this improve data protection?
The system operates under updated regulations that enforce controlled access, data minimization, and compliance standards.
